It has been just over six months since our last USA Cycling race, but that void gets filled in a big way starting Monday with seven consecutive days of racing.

Half Acre Cycling’s Gapers Block Crit Series (nee Kevin’s Crits) gets it started with evening races through Friday. Calumet Park offers smooth, gentle turns and recent visitors tell me the pavement is in good shape and the lights are functioning. For beginners eager to upgrade, this is a good opportunity to quickly get five mass-start races under their belts.

Pre-registration has filled for the two men’s 4/5’s heats, but 10 day-of slots are reserved for each day’s heat on a first-come, first-served basis. More details here.

Only two Cat 3 women pre-registered. This may mean the 3’s and 4’s fields will be combined. I’ll rely on Half Acre representation to clarify in the comments.

After a cold, wet weekend, it looks like Half Acre will enjoy decent weather all week. It will still get nippy after the sun goes down, doubly so if there’s wind off the lake, so dress appropriately (especially if you’re one of the generous people who have volunteered to marshal).
